I bought this pump to use as I am nursing, but needed something reliable for when I had to be away from baby girl. We didn't want to spend a ridiculous amount and thought this was a reasonable price. I did end up receiving a Medela Pump 'n Style Advanced as a gift, so I have a good perspective to compare with. Pros: the breast shields on the Lansinoh are fantastic, the rubber around the rim makes for a great seal. The suction is definitely comparable to the Medela. Also the suction and speed are individually adjustable, which is not the case on the Medela. It has a digital timer on it, awesome for keeping track of how long you are pumping. Handy feature at 3 am. The only con is that it is quite a bit louder. The Medela is more discreet when it comes to noise, if you're pumping in the same room as your sleeping baby, this might matter. All in all, it was a great purchase. I kept my two pumps in separate locations so I didn't have to tote one around and got great use out of both.
